San Antonio

San Antonio is a district of the canton, in the province of . San Antonio has about 11,700 residents and an elevation of 900 metres.
Tap on a place
to explore it
  • Type: Town with 11,700 residents
  • Description: district in Belén canton, Heredia province, Costa Rica
  • Also known as: San Antonio de Belen”, “San Antonio de Belén”, and “San Antonio District, Belén
  • Postal code: 40701
